About Dew School

Dew School is a public elementary school in Teague, TX, part of DEW ISD. Dew School serves approximately 181 students, and covers grades Pre-K-8th, and has a 10.6:1 student-teacher ratio. Dew School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.3 out of 10 and ranks #4,392 of 8,552 schools in TX.

Structured state assessment records for Dew School show 66%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 71%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

At 181 students, Dew School is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

Dew School s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
